Cooling Maintenance

Regular maintenance keeps your cooling system running efficiently. Our professional HVAC contractors carry out thorough maintenance services that include:

  • Cleaning or replacing air filters
  • Examining refrigerant levels
  • Cleaning up condenser and evaporator coils
  • Checking and cleaning up drain lines
  • Inspecting electrical connections
  • Oiling moving parts
  • Testing thermostat operation
  • Validating proper airflow

Heater Maintenance

Regular maintenance prevents lots of heating problems and extends the life of your system. Our expert HVAC professionals perform extensive maintenance services that include:

  •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
  • Examining combustion performance
  • Evaluating security controls
  • Cleaning up or changing filters
  • Inspecting electrical connections
  • Lubing moving parts
  • Cleaning burners and adjusting the flame

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ted air flow makes your system work harder and minimizes convenience. Our HVAC professionals determine airflow problems, whether triggered by duct issues, filthy filters, or fan issues.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ct issues, insulation concerns, or an incorrectly sized system. Our expert HVAC specialists can identify these issues and advise options.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system switches on and off frequently, it loses energy and wears out components much faster. Our HVAC contractors can figure out whether the issue stems from a clogged up filter, improper thermostat settings, or something more severe.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ected boosts in energy costs frequently suggest HVAC ineffectiveness. Our contractors carry out energy effectiveness assessments to determine the cause and suggest impro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ems must assist man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er season or too dry in winter season, our HVAC contractors can suggest services to enhance com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    In some cases what looks like a system failure is actually a thermostat problem. Our HVAC specialists can repair or change thermostats and help you update to programmable or wise designs for much better convenience control and energy savings.
